Typical roofing prices in Coventry

ServicePrice rangeDuration
Roof repair (minor leak/tiles)£150 – £500Half day
Ridge tile repointing£300 – £8001 day
Flat roof repair£200 – £1,0001–2 days
Full flat roof (GRP/EPDM)£1,500 – £4,0002–3 days
Full roof replacement£5,000 – £12,0001–2 weeks
Chimney repointing & flashing£300 – £1,2001–2 days
Guttering replacement (full)£400 – £9001 day
Fascia & soffit renewal£1,200 – £3,0002–3 days

Prices are approximate for the Coventry area. Get a free quote for an accurate price.
